This opportunity is focused on leading project schedule development, progress measurement, forecasting, and change management within a complex oil and gas environment. The role supports integrated planning activities, contractor schedule oversight, and schedule recovery planning, with a strong emphasis on Primavera P6, project controls, and work breakdown structure alignment. This position offers the chance to contribute directly to project delivery, trend analysis, and capital efficiency across a significant site-based programme.

Requirements:

  • Bachelor of Science degree in Engineering, Engineering Technology, or Construction Management

  • Experience in project controls, project services, and/or planning and scheduling

  • Supervisory experience

  • Experience developing, maintaining, reviewing, and forecasting integrated project schedules

  • Experience assessing contractor and company-generated schedules, including baseline and progress measurement activities

  • Experience in schedule impact review, corrective action planning, and recovery plan development

  • Experience with either company projects or Advanced Work Packaging (AWP)

  • Advanced competency in Primavera P6 or equivalent scheduling software

  • Strong capability in schedule development, control, forecasting, and progress measurement

  • Ability to review schedule logic, level of detail, interfaces, timing, and alignment with control estimates, work breakdown structures, and project plans

  • Ability to monitor contractor performance against approved baseline schedules and support corrective action planning

  • Strong analytical, influencing, consulting, and mentoring skills

  • Excellent interpersonal communication skills and the ability to respond quickly to urgent analysis requests

  • Adaptability to changing priorities and the ability to manage multiple tasks effectively
